This Columbia home had one deck which descended directly into their backyard. Rather than tuck their seven person hot tub on the concrete patio below their deck, we constructed a new tier.
Their new deck was built with composite decking, making it completely maintenance free. Constructed with three feet concrete piers and post bases attaching each support according to code, this new deck can easily withstand the weight of hundreds of gallons of water and a dozen or more people.
Aluminum rails line the stairs and surround the entire deck for aesthetics as well as safety. Taller aluminum supports form a privacy screen with horizontal cedar wood slats. The cedar wall also sports four clothes hooks for robes. The family now has a private place to relax and entertain in their own backyard.

We framed this large 15'x22' deck in pressure treated lumber, with helical piles from Techno Metal Post and custom engineered brackets exclusively for Mjolnir Construction to act as the foundation.
Western red cedar was used as decking with a picture frame deck edge and mid span border to break up the deck area.
Custom stair treads set this deck apart from others with mitered corners, also done with western red cedar.
Aluminum railing from Imperial Kool Ray gives the deck a sleek, modern finish which will require no maintenance and be a strong guardrail for years to come.
Notice all of the brackets used in the framing from Simpson Strong-Tie to ensure a continuous load path and stable structure!

Rooftopia developed and built a truly one of a kind rooftop paradise on two roof levels at this Michigan Ave residence. Our inspiration came from the gorgeous historical architecture of the building. Our design and development process began about a year before the project was permitted and could begin construction. Our installation teams mobilized over 100 individual pieces of steel & ipe pergola by hand through a small elevator and stair access for assembly and fabrication onsite. We integrated a unique steel screen pattern into the design surrounding a loud utility area and added a highly regarded product called Acoustiblok to achieve significant noise reduction. The custom 18 foot bar ledge has 360° views of the city skyline and lake Michigan. The luxury outdoor kitchen maximizes the options with a built in grill, dishwasher, ice maker, refrigerator and sink. The day bed is a soft oasis in the sea of buildings. Large planters emphasize the grand entrance, flanking new limestone steps and handrails, and soften the cityscape with a mix of lush perennials and annuals. A small green roof space adds to the overall aesthetic and attracts pollinators to assist with the client's veggie garden. Truly a dream for relaxing, outdoor dining and entertaining!

The brief for this modern coastal home was to create a place where the clients and their children and their families could gather to enjoy all the beauty of living in Southern California. Maximizing the lot was key to unlocking the potential of this property so the decision was made to excavate the entire property to allow natural light and ventilation to circulate through the lower level of the home.
A courtyard with a green wall and olive tree act as the lung for the building as the coastal breeze brings fresh air in and circulates out the old through the courtyard.
The concept for the home was to be living on a deck, so the large expanse of glass doors fold away to allow a seamless connection between the indoor and outdoors and feeling of being out on the deck is felt on the interior. A huge cantilevered beam in the roof allows for corner to completely disappear as the home looks to a beautiful ocean view and Dana Point harbor in the distance. All of the spaces throughout the home have a connection to the outdoors and this creates a light, bright and healthy environment.
Passive design principles were employed to ensure the building is as energy efficient as possible. Solar panels keep the building off the grid and and deep overhangs help in reducing the solar heat gains of the building. Ultimately this home has become a place that the families can all enjoy together as the grand kids create those memories of spending time at the beach.

This lakefront diamond in the rough lot was waiting to be discovered by someone with a modern naturalistic vision and passion. Maintaining an eco-friendly, and sustainable build was at the top of the client priority list. Designed and situated to benefit from passive and active solar as well as through breezes from the lake, this indoor/outdoor living space truly establishes a symbiotic relationship with its natural surroundings. The pie-shaped lot provided significant challenges with a street width of 50ft, a steep shoreline buffer of 50ft, as well as a powerline easement reducing the buildable area. The client desired a smaller home of approximately 2500sf that juxtaposed modern lines with the free form of the natural setting. The 250ft of lakefront afforded 180-degree views which guided the design to maximize this vantage point while supporting the adjacent environment through preservation of heritage trees. Prior to construction the shoreline buffer had been rewilded with wildflowers, perennials, utilization of clover and meadow grasses to support healthy animal and insect re-population. The inclusion of solar panels as well as hydroponic heated floors and wood stove supported the owner’s desire to be self-sufficient. Core ten steel was selected as the predominant material to allow it to “rust” as it weathers thus blending into the natural environment.
